Why short circuit rating usually at 3 sec indicated by most of suppliers?, why not 1 sec, 2 sec?
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
3 seconds is a typical design limit for the clearance of a fault by back-up protection.
It's possible to specify other times - eg 1s, certainly in respect of cable short-circuit withstand, which may be used where the back-up protection will clear a fault inside this time. ------------------------- Jonno |
